## Formula sandbox tuning

User-supplied formulas in Gridmoor execute inside a restricted interpreter with hard ceilings on time, memory, and call depth. Reviewers should confirm any change to these ceilings is justified in the PR description, since raising them widens the abuse surface. Defaults were chosen from production traces. The current limits are as follows.

limits module of tafog-fawip:
WEIGHTS = {
    "julix": 57,
    "lamys": 992,
    "kasvan": 209,
    "quenok": 750,
    "alddor": 259,
    "oliath": 1009,
    "wenix": 815,
}

= FY Headcount Plan (Managers Only) =

Orbanex Holdings. Board summary. Net growth: +14 roles. Engineering +9, field sales +4, operations +1. Marketing frozen pending the Quillford campaign review. Attrition assumption: 8%. All hires gated on Q2 revenue checkpoint. Contractor conversions capped at five. Regional allocation favours the Dunmere site; the Averly office holds flat. Exceptions require sign-off from both finance and the people committee. The confidential business-plan note is appended immediately below.

confidential, kagup-bafog: Fraaxax Group is in early talks to buy Soroxox Group for about $343.8 million. The Olidor launch date is June 14, and nothing goes to the press before then. Legal wants the Aldmirek Logistics term sheet signed before July 23.

TURN-208: Gatevale turnstile counters at the Merrow Field pilot double-count when a rotation reverses mid-cycle. Attendance totals drift roughly 2% high per event. The debounce window fix is implemented, reviewed by Ilsa, and soak-tested across two simulated match days without drift. Ready for your cut; the candidate build is identified below.

trace token, tagag-tafog: htk6_5ed18c